We start with immigration: USCIS has raised the bar on goodmoral character. Expressions of anti-Americanism may now count against applicants when seeking immigration benefits, making it more important than ever to understand what’s at stake.
August is Make a Will Month — the perfect time to protect your family, secure your assets, and make sure your legacy is carried out the way you intend.
In bankruptcy news, exemptions can provide vitalprotections. From your home to personal belongings, knowing what’s safe from creditors can make the difference between despair and a true fresh start.
